Summary

Cherokee Elementary is a public elementary school in Memphis, Tennessee, serving 368 students in grades PK-5. The school is part of the Memphis-Shelby County Schools district, which is ranked 135 out of 139 districts in the state and has a 0-star rating from SchoolDigger.

Cherokee Elementary has consistently ranked in the bottom 20% of Tennessee elementary schools, with its performance on state assessments significantly below the state and district averages across all grades and subjects. For example, in 2024-2025, only 36.9% of students were proficient or better in Mathematics, compared to 42.2% statewide and 22.6% in the Memphis-Shelby County district. The school's performance is particularly low for male students and English Language Learners, ranking in the bottom 25% of Tennessee elementary schools for these subgroups. Additionally, Cherokee Elementary has had high rates of chronic absenteeism, ranging from 18.9% to 48.1% over the past few years, significantly higher than the state and district averages.

While the nearby schools, such as South Park Elementary, Getwell Elementary, and Sherwood Elementary, also perform poorly compared to the state, some schools, like Campus School, a public magnet school, perform significantly better, ranking in the top 5% of Tennessee elementary schools. The high rates of chronic absenteeism at Cherokee Elementary and the nearby schools are a significant concern and may be contributing to the low academic performance, despite the increased spending per student in recent years.
